Can testosterone therapy affect my fertility?
This is an important question. Standard testosterone replacement can actually suppress sperm production, so fertility optimization in men requires a careful, specialized approach. Dr. Redmond's men's health training allows her to optimize hormones in ways that support — rather than compromise — your fertility goals. This is exactly why a thorough evaluation matters before starting any therapy.
